Water Damage Coverage Upgrades
Standard property coverage rarely includes flood protection—critical in low-lying areas of Orlando. Adding Orlando flood insurance can reduce devastating out-of-pocket costs. Since Florida faces frequent heavy rains and drainage challenges, this add-on is a smart move for long-term security.

Required Documentation
To enroll in a multi-policy plan, you’ll need several key documents. These include your home deed, recent appraisal or inspection report, and current insurance declarations. If bundling with auto, have your insurance history ready. Being prepared speeds up the insurance quote online.

Switching Without Gaps
Never let your property damage protection lapse—even for a day. A gap can lead to denied claims or higher rates later. Schedule your insurance combo to start the day after your old one ends. Confirm the activation windows with both insurers to avoid overlaps or holes.

Moisture-Related Home Risks
Orlando’s moist air can lead to mold, warped wood, and electrical issues. Most standard policies exclude mold damage unless you add a rider. Look for insurers offering humidity protection—especially in older homes. This add-on could save you from costly remediation.
